Meta Tries to Break the End-to-End Encryption Deadlock

After years of tech corporations and police fumbling and clashing over end-to-end encryption, Meta this week brandished a brand new software in its arsenal that will assist the social media big resist authorities strain to vary course or weaken its plan to implement end-to-end encryption throughout its non-public communication companies.

On Monday, Meta published a report concerning the human rights impacts of end-to-end encryption produced by Enterprise for Social Accountability, a nonprofit centered on company impacts. Meta, which commissioned the unbiased BSR report, additionally revealed its response. In a research that took greater than two years to finish, BSR discovered that end-to-end encryption is overwhelmingly optimistic and essential for safeguarding human rights, nevertheless it additionally delved into the prison exercise and violent extremism that may discover secure haven on end-to-end encrypted platforms. Crucially, the report additionally affords suggestions for how one can doubtlessly mitigate these damaging impacts. 

Since 2019, Meta has said that it’s going to ultimately convey end-to-end encryption to all of its messaging platforms. The safety measure, designed to field companies out of accessing their customers’ communications, has already long been deployed on the Meta-owned platform WhatsApp, however the initiative would convey the safety to Fb Messenger and Instagram Direct Messenger as nicely. Meta has mentioned that its delay in totally deploying end-to-end encryption on these different companies largely has to do with technical challenges and interoperability points, however the firm has additionally confronted criticism concerning the plan from america authorities and different nations around the globe over considerations that including the characteristic would make it tougher for the corporate and regulation enforcement to counter a variety of threats, like little one abuse and distribution of kid sexual abuse materials, coordinated disinformation campaigns, viral hate speech, terrorism, and violent extremism. The US authorities, and the FBI particularly, has long argued that complete encryption that protects person knowledge equally protects suspects from criminal investigations, thus endangering the general public and national security.

“I’m glad to see BSR’s report affirm the essential position that encryption performs in defending human rights,” says Riana Pfefferkorn, a analysis scholar on the Stanford Web Observatory who was not concerned within the research. “Whereas it’s true that undesirable conduct happens in encrypted contexts, most individuals aren’t criminals, whereas everybody wants privateness and safety. Weakening encryption will not be the reply.”

The query for Meta and privateness advocates around the globe has been how one can develop mechanisms for stopping digital abuse earlier than it begins, flagging doubtlessly suspicious conduct with out getting access to customers’ precise communications, and creating mechanisms that enable customers to successfully report doubtlessly abusive conduct. Even very latest efforts to strike a steadiness have been met with intense criticism by privateness and encryption advocates. 

For instance, Apple introduced plans in August to debut a characteristic that will scan user’s data locally on their devices for child sexual abuse material. That method, the reasoning went, Apple would not must entry the info immediately or compile it within the cloud to test for abusive materials. Researchers raised a number of considerations, although, concerning the potential for such a mechanism to be manipulated and abused and the danger that it would not even accomplish its objective if the system produced a slew of false positives and false negatives. Inside a month, Apple backed down, saying it wanted time to reassess the scheme.
